1. Understand Your Readers
To create a successful content marketing strategy, you must first understand your target audience’s needs and preferences.
Find out about the demographics, buying habits, interests, and goals of your audience.
It could include prospects, leads, customers, advocates, partners, investors, donors, volunteers, and board members.
Your ideal customers and target groups can be described by buyer personas.
Find any gaps in the needs and pain points of your audience so that you can please them with content.
Think about where, when, and how your audience reads and watches content.
This will affect the type of content, format, and channels that are used. This will help you create content that your audience will find interesting and useful.

2. Content Calendar & Workflow
Plan and organize content creation. Content marketing often faces challenges due to a lack of data and strategy, according to a DMA study.
So it is important to make an editorial content calendar. It should list themes, types, and channels for distributing content.
This calendar doesn’t need to be complex. It can be either a detailed monthly plan or a simple weekly plan.
Sticking to this calendar will help you keep your content consistent and track your results better.
A simple spreadsheet is usually enough for most businesses. It is essential to ensure all responsible parties have access to the calendar.
There are several templates and tools available online. These can help you create an editorial content calendar that works for your business.

4. Set SMART Goals
Set success metrics for the content you are using. Setting SMART goals for your content strategy is a good way to do this.
SMART: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Timebound.
SMART goals help you be clear about your content goals, make sure they fit with your business goals as a whole, and keep track of your progress and performance.
5. Content Repurposing
Reusing your content in different ways, like changing the format, style, or form, can help it last longer.
Create a plan for reusing your best content to get the most out of it.
Check your analytics to see what type of content is more liked by your target audience.
Find the content that is doing the best for you and change it into something a little different.
For example, you could turn a blog post into a white paper or a checklist into a video.

9. Storytelling
Content marketing strategy involves telling an interesting story.
The story may contain suspense, action, emotion, drama, intensity, and entertainment.
A great story has three essential elements: characters, conflict, and resolution.
The characters represent client types. The story is what the audience needs, wants, or is having trouble with.
Conflict is what makes a story interesting. Resolution is when you share your knowledge and skills to help other people solve their problems.

13. Balance Evergreen and Trending Content
Evergreen and trending content have their advantages and drawbacks. Evergreen content lasts for a long time.
So you can focus on using old content instead of making new content.
Trending content keeps you up to date and in the current scenario. But you must act quickly and ensure it is relevant to your audience.
The best way to get the most out of both types is to use both in your strategy.
If trending topics do not make sense for your business, do not use them in your content strategy.

19. Engagement Metrics
See how your content is affecting your audience by keeping an eye on likes, comments, brand mentions, and social media engagement.
Pay close attention to specific questions or comments that let you know where you can add more information or detail in future posts.
Observe the type of content that gets the most interaction.
20. Content Refresher
You should always be updating your content because the digital world is always changing.
Update your best-performing content with new facts, figures, and examples regularly.
This will help you keep a high search engine ranking and make sure your content stays useful and relevant to your audience.
